As the poultry industry continues to grow, so does the issue of managing the waste produced by poultry farms. Poultry waste includes things like manure, feathers, bedding material, and mortalities. Improper disposal of this waste can lead to environmental pollution, foul odors, and the spread of diseases. One effective solution to this problem is the use of a poultry waste incinerator.
A poultry waste incinerator is a specialized piece of equipment designed to safely and efficiently dispose of poultry waste through the process of combustion. This technology has been widely adopted by poultry farms around the world due to its numerous benefits. Let’s explore some of the key advantages of using a poultry waste incinerator.

2. Disease Prevention
Poultry waste can harbor dangerous pathogens and bacteria that pose a threat to both animal and human health. By incinerating the waste at high temperatures, a poultry waste incinerator can effectively sterilize the material, killing off any harmful microbes. This helps prevent the spread of diseases and ensures a safer working environment for farm workers.

4. Energy Generation
Incinerating poultry waste generates heat energy that can be harnessed and used for various purposes. Many poultry waste incinerators are equipped with heat recovery systems that capture the heat produced during combustion and convert it into energy. This energy can be used to power on-site operations or even sold back to the grid, providing an additional source of revenue for the farm.
5. Waste Volume Reduction
Poultry waste can take up a significant amount of space on the farm if not properly managed. By incinerating the waste, its volume is greatly reduced, resulting in less storage space required. This can be especially beneficial for farms with limited land resources or for those looking to optimize their waste management practices.
